Why does a garbage disposal hum but not spin?
A jammed flywheel or impeller prevents spinning while the motor hums. Unplug the unit and rotate the blades manually with an Allen wrench to clear the jam. Contact (833) 607-2061 for repair help in Englewood, NJ.
How does repair cost compare to replacement?
Repair often runs 100 to 200 dollars for common issues while full replacement averages 300 to 500 dollars installed. A unit older than ten years usually warrants replacement instead.
What does the reset button do on a garbage disposal?
The red reset button restores power after an overload trips the internal circuit breaker. Press it after clearing any jam and restoring power.
Can a garbage disposal work with a septic system?
Yes, but only with models designed for septic use and regular enzyme treatments. Overloading the system still risks drain field damage.
Do garbage disposals need a dedicated circuit?
A 15 or 20 amp circuit is required, and sharing the line with other appliances can cause tripped breakers. Most local codes specify this setup.
